If you are moving from one user interface 6.1, don't be concerned about the large update (more than 5 GB in size). To install it, go to the settings, click update the program, then choose the download and installation. Samsung recommends connecting Wi -Fi and ensuring that your phone has a lot of battery before starting the update.
